DC uninterruptible power supply for fire protection
Designed for 2 or 3 outputs and protected from overload and short circuit, it provides fault indication and eliminates the deep discharge of batteries - Temperature compensated charging - Input: one single phase (115-230-277 Vac) - Output: 12-24-48 VDC - Temperature compensation - Deep discharge protections - IUoUO charging curve, constant voltage and constant current Battery-Life Test function (Battery Care) - Four charging modes: Recovery, Boost, Absorption, Float - Protected against short circuit and reverse polarity - Output signal (contact-free) for discharged or damaged battery, Modbus, main and back-up - Combinable with DC UPS series - Wall mounted - Protection degree: IP30 - Complies with EN54-4 [pdf]
